Here's some extra stuff:

  1. Network / C2 Infrastructure

    C2 Domain: Code: edgeserv.ru C2 Destination IP: Code: 95.214.234.238 C2 Port: Code: 8041 (TCP) Traffic Pattern: Regular outbound beaconing/handshake attempts every 30 to 60 minutes initiated by background client services.

  2. Dropped Binaries & Masqueraded Paths

    Malicious Install Directory: Code: C:\Program Files (x86)\Windows VC
    (masquerading as Microsoft Visual C++) Dropped Executables: Code: ScreenConnect.ClientService.exe Code: ScreenConnect.WindowsClient.exe Service Name / Masquerade: ScreenConnect Client registered under the guise of "Visual C++" to persist across reboots under Code: LocalSystem / Code: SYSTEM privileges.

  3. Bundled Installer & Heuristic Detections

    Patch Binary: Code: ...\Stardock\Start11\x64-patch.exe (Flags as Code: HackTool:Win32/Keygen ) Cached Installer Artifact: Code: C:\Windows\Installer[random].msi Threat Classification: Code: Trojan:Win32/Malgent!MTB / Code: PUA:Win32/ConnectWise Attack Method: Abuse of legitimate remote management software (ScreenConnect/ConnectWise Control). The repackaged installer quietly provisions a persistent background service pointing to unauthorized third-party infrastructure ( Code: edgeserv.ru / Code: 95.214.234.238 ) during the cracked software setup."

My experience with Brixadi (Buprenorphine monthly shot) and the jump off of it

To give some background information, i started taking suboxone in 2013. It was intermittent at first but eventually evolved into daily use. In 2016 I started treatment (basically going from buying bupe on the street to getting an rx for it) and was put on 16mg daily.

I was on that 16mg daily until 2023, when i switched to brixadi because i had a wedding coming up and i didn't want to have to worry about tablets etc during it, like having to sneak off to let a tablet dissolve under my tongue. I stuck with the brixadi shot from 2023 until earlier this year.

Started at 128mg/month, worked my way down to 30mg/month which is about 1.5-2mg/day oral equivalent of tablets.

I have tried to quit multiple times over the years and it never stuck for more than a few weeks. It's been two months now and the worst withdrawal symptoms i noticed were general apathy/exhaustion. Two months later, i'm feeling pretty damn normal.

The reason I'm sharing this is because the brixadi shot is what allowed me to finally jump off completely. Getting rid of the tablet routine was a huge factor in all of this. When i've tried to quit in the past, there was almost a psychological compulsion to take the tablet out of routine. The monthly shot allowed me to end that routine.

For anyone looking to jump off of suboxone, i would highly recommend switching to the brixadi shot. Breaking the psychological routine of taking the tablets and having them linked to how you feel was key for me. The shot is flexible enough where you can get down to a sub 1mg daily dose of bupe over time while also removing the psychological component of the tablets.

I was expecting to be out of commission for weeks but it's been gentle af lol, the only thing i take occasionally is gabapentin, maybe 1/2 a 600mg every other day.

tl;dr if you're having a hard time quitting bupe, consider switching from tablets/films to the shot and reducing your dose gradually over months until you get to the point where the doctor is squirting 3/4 of the shot into the trash before they give you it. At that point, jumping off is mostly psychological. You also have the added bonus of the shot being its own taper. When you discontinue it, there's a depot of medicine in your arm still that slowly releases itself over a week or two and makes it more of a gradual drop vs dosing with tablets where your blood levels of buprenorphine will vary wildly on the taper throughout the day.

I hope this helps someone out there, i wish i would've been aware of the shot earlier because it's a literal game changer for addiction treatment.

AC Valhalla crackfix for windows 11, DODI/EMPRESS repack fix

I spent the last 2 hours trying to figure out how to launch this game on a modern system, tried everything. all the normal suspects. nothing. I ended up finding a link to a google drive with a replacement dll file. I dragged and dropped it and it worked and i don't want this to be lost to future generations.

Symptoms- When you launch the game exe as admin, you get the splash screen for a second then it vanishes with no error

Solution- Drop this dll over the existing one.

Windows 11 d3dcompiler_47.dll, replace the existing d3dcompiler_47.dll with the new one and launch as administrator.

I'm pretty sure this is the same file dodi had on his site under >Windows 11 24H2 Crackfix skystar

The link on his site no longer works, this is a mirror of that one.

I was lucky enough to be able to get my hands on one of these thanks to the lilygo team and I've had around a week to play with the hardware. This is my take so far on the unit.

  • The form factor is amazing for EDC.
  • The solar panel is great, this thing sips power so expect your battery to last 5+ days.
  • The OLED screen is a very nice addition to what are typically headless units in this form factor.
  • The IP66 rating means you don't have to worry if it starts to drizzle on you while hiking. The assembly is very solid, they use a gasket when assembling the unit that is still waterproof after pulling it apart and putting it back together.
  • The magnetic usb connector requires you to carry a specialized USB cable with you while out in the field. Having to carry around a special cable for something meant for an EDC/ruggedized unit seems like an oversight. There are USB-C waterproof connectors with covers on them that would be a better alternative imo.

Overall, for what it is, it's a very impressive little piece of hardware. I cannot wait for meshtastic to roll out some firmware for this device. This is something you can clip on your backpack and go camping for a weekend and never worry about getting lost or it dying on you or getting fried due to some morning dew.

If we're comparing it to similar form factor units, the biggest upgrade over existing ones is the integration of solar and a (tiny) OLED. You'll be able to read your meshtastic messages without having to pair over BLE. That means you can grab it off your backpack and read the screen instead of having to go through another device to read a message.

8/10 hardware. The nrf based architecture consumes so much less power than an esp32 based unit. If this thing had a standardized USB connection I'd raise that to a 9/10.
